HEPA, PM2.5, and Cardiometabolic Health

The goal of this randomized, double-blind, crossover trial is to test the hypothesis that a longer-term indoor HEPA filtration intervention can improve cardiometabolic profiles by reducing indoor PM2.5 exposures in at-risk individuals.

Adding the Immunotherapy Drug Cemiplimab to Usual Treatment for People With Advanced Non-Small Cell Lung Cancer Who Had Previous Treatment With Platinum Chemotherapy and Immunotherapy (An Expanded Lung-MAP Treatment Trial)

This phase II/III Expanded Lung-MAP treatment trial compares the effect of adding cemiplimab to docetaxel and ramucirumab versus docetaxel and ramucirumab alone in treating patients with non-small cell lung cancer that is stage IV or that has come back after a period of improvement (recurrent). A Study of BMS-986490 With or Without Bevacizumab in Advanced Solid Tumors

This is a study of BMS-986490 as a monotherapy and in combination with bevacizumab in participants with select advanced solid tumors known to express CEACAM5.

Eganelisib as Monotherapy and in Combination With Cytarabine in Relapsed/Refractory AML

This is a Phase 1b open-label, multicenter, dose-escalation and dose-optimization study designed to evaluate the safety, tolerability, pharmacokinetics (PK), pharmacodynamics (PD), and anti-tumor efficacy of eganelisib as monotherapy and in combination with cytarabine in patients with relapsed/refractory (r/r) acute myeloid leukemia (AML) or r/r higher-risk myelodysplastic syndromes (HR-MDS).
